The lawsuits for wrongful death are an important aspect of mesothelioma lawsuits. These lawsuits are filed by family members who have suffered the loss of a loved one because of asbestos exposure. Families could be entitled to compensation for funeral costs as well as loss of companionship and other damages.

Depending on their state the family members and victims may be entitled to compensation from asbestos trust fund. These trusts are created through the bankruptcy of companies that previously produced or used asbestos. They are meant to protect assets that could be used to pay asbestos-related legal costs. Trusts like these can boost the amount of settlements made for mesothelioma to a substantial amount.
